MicroRNA 518d is a small (about 22 nucleotides), non-coding RNA molecule belonging to the microRNA family, located within the large C19MC cluster on chromosome 19. It regulates gene expression post-transcriptionally, typically by binding the 3' untranslated regions of target mRNAs, leading to mRNA degradation or translational repression. miR-518d is implicated in cellular processes such as proliferation, apoptosis, and differentiation, and may be dysregulated in certain cancers and developmental contexts. Its broad role in gene regulatory networks makes it of research interest, but limits its specificity as a therapeutic drug target.
miR-518d acts via base-pairing with complementary sequences in target mRNAs, resulting in translation repression or mRNA destabilization. Antisense oligonucleotides targeting miR-518d would theoretically block its activity.
